A warm and cozy soup for chilly fall and winter nights. This recipe is quick and easy but with all the comfort of homemade.

Ingredients

  • 3 cups chicken broth
  • 2 cloves garlic , minced
  • 1.5 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 0.75 teaspoons white sugar
  • 1 carrot , thinly sliced
  • 1 stalk celery , thinly sliced
  • 1 cup potato gnocchi
  • 4 ounces frozen peas
  • 4 ounces frozen corn
  • 1 cup shredded cooked chicken
  • 2 ounces baby spinach
  • sal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• 0.5 cups grated Parmesan cheese , or to taste

Instructions

  1. 1

    Combine chicken broth, garlic, butter, and sugar in a large saucepan; bring to a simmer and cook until garlic is tender, about 2 minutes. Stir carrot and celery into simmering broth; cook until vegetables are almost tender, about 2 minutes more.

  2. 2

    Bring broth mixture to a boil and stir gnocchi into the saucepan; cook until gnocchi rise to the top and are tender yet firm to the bite, 2 to 3 minutes. Add peas and corn to broth mixture; simmer until heated through, about 30 seconds.

  3. 3

    Stir chicken and spinach into broth mixture; remove from heat and season soup with salt and black pepper. Ladle soup into bowls and top with Parmesan cheese.
